标题:数据库主从实时备份策略:保障数据安全与高效
随着信息技术的飞速发展,数据已经成为企业的重要资产。数据库作为存储和管理数据的中心,其稳定性和安全性对企业至关重要。为了确保数据的安全,数据库的备份变得尤为重要。本文将介绍数据库主从实时备份的策略,以保障数据的安全与高效。
一、数据库主从备份概述
数据库主从备份是指将主数据库的数据同步到从数据库,从而实现数据的备份。主数据库是生产环境中的数据库,从数据库是备份环境中的数据库。主从备份可以分为以下几种类型:
-
同步备份:主从数据库的数据实时同步,从数据库的数据与主数据库完全一致。
-
异步备份:主从数据库的数据同步存在延迟,从数据库的数据可能与主数据库存在一定差异。
-
全量备份:备份整个数据库,包括所有表、索引、视图等。
-
增量备份:只备份自上次备份以来发生变化的数据。
二、数据库主从实时备份策略
- 选择合适的备份工具
选择一款合适的备份工具对于数据库主从实时备份至关重要。目前市面上有许多优秀的备份工具,如MySQL Workbench、Percona XtraBackup、Veeam Backup & Replication等。在选择备份工具时,应考虑以下因素:
(1)支持多种数据库类型;
(2)支持主从备份;
(3)备份速度快、效率高;
(4)易于管理和维护。
- 设计合理的备份架构
在设计备份架构时,应考虑以下因素:
(1)主从数据库的地理位置:尽量选择距离较近的主从数据库,以降低网络延迟;
(2)备份频率:根据业务需求,确定合适的备份频率,如每小时、每天等;
(3)备份策略:根据数据重要性,选择全量备份、增量备份或混合备份。
- 实现主从同步
实现主从同步是数据库主从实时备份的关键。以下是一些实现主从同步的方法:
(1)使用MySQL Replication:MySQL Replication是MySQL官方提供的主从同步机制,支持异步和同步两种模式。通过配置主从数据库的复制参数,可以实现数据的实时同步。
(2)使用第三方工具:如Veeam Backup & Replication、Percona XtraBackup等,这些工具提供了更加灵活的主从同步功能。
- 监控备份过程
在备份过程中,应实时监控备份状态,确保备份过程顺利进行。以下是一些监控备份的方法:
(1)查看备份日志:备份工具通常会生成备份日志,记录备份过程中的详细信息。
(2)监控备份性能:关注备份速度、磁盘空间使用情况等指标。
(3)设置报警机制:当备份失败或出现异常时,及时发出报警,以便快速定位问题。
三、总结
数据库主从实时备份是保障数据安全与高效的重要手段。通过选择合适的备份工具、设计合理的备份架构、实现主从同步以及监控备份过程,可以有效提高数据库备份的稳定性和可靠性。在实际应用中,企业应根据自身业务需求,选择合适的备份策略,确保数据的安全与高效。
转载请注明来自泉州固洁建材有限公司,本文标题:《数据库主从实时备份策略:保障数据安全与高效》